Radamel Falcao has reiterated that Atletico Madrid’s mindset for the weekend derby with Real Madrid is to look for the win.

Atleti have not won home or away to their rivals since a 3-1 win in October 1999 at the Santiago Bernabeu, but striker Falcao believes three points is all the team are aiming for from this Saturday’s meeting.

“The players are going with the ambition of winning, I do not find myself comfortable with a draw,” he told Cadena Ser.

“After certain circumstances in the game then a draw may prove to be good, but when the players take to the field they are going out to win.

“A draw a good result? The players think differently, we always want to win and this is how we face our challenges. There is a competitive spirit to win and beat the opponent, it is instinctive.

“I have played many important derbies and external situations in this kind of match are forgotten. Players go out there to win without any weight on their backs.

“Madrid will assume that we will have an attitude that is not relaxed.”

Falcao was asked of his side’s poor record against Madrid and why he believed this time would be different for Atleti at the Bernabeu.

“We have renewed enthusiasm for a new opportunity offered in football against our rival, it is a game we all want to play and win. We are looking forward to it.

“We know the situation at both clubs, the circumstances, but that will not influence the derby, players forget that and go out there to win.”
